Hm, in case a third-party application that youāre unaware of could be interfering/utilising Interception driver, I recommend trying a Selective Startup:
Press the Windows key
Type āmsconfigā and select āSystem Configurationā
On the āGeneralā tab, select āSelective Startupā
Deselect āLoad startup Itemsā
Reboot your PC
Launch Vermintide 2 as normal
Alternatively, browser searching āuninstall Interception driverā should point you in the right direction, as there appears to be a command line method to uninstall this. Though itās not something Iām familiar with, or can advise on specifically unfortunately.
